Approx 1.86 KM away
Address: Philippines
Approx 1.87 KM away
Address: Northbound, Avenida Epifanio de los Santos, Cubao, Quezon City, Metro Manila, Philippines
Approx 1.90 KM away
Approx 1.94 KM away
Approx 1.99 KM away